As the lead programmer and head trainer here at CrossFit Works, I take coaching young athletes incredibly seriously. There are a variety of important aspects to training young people. First and foremost is the safety aspect. Young bodies entering puberty and growth spurts are incredibly complicated. Bones grow faster than muscles and connective tissue. What is safe for an adult is not safe for a teenager. What is safe for a teenager one day is not safe for them the next week. Training young people is one of the most serious undertakings in the field of athletic training. Secondly, is the “I-will-live-forever-and-can-do-anything” mentality that characterizes young people and makes them so incredibly wonderful and yet, dangerous to themselves. It is a responsibility of the trainer to be knowledgeable enough and be a strong enough leader, to prevent young athletes from performing lifts or exercises that could cause them permanent harm. Just because they can do it, doesn’t mean they should do it! Perfect form is important. Thirdly, is that keeping young kids focused, safe and inspired is a special gift.
